Transaction 51afcaabb84eb4a0f7fbb064a24103bedb37ca9165e3a26a37f9bca2c3a67fbe

block
186364c23b454a1375e0c11634f365c0404b6016df10b253a88251b17f077419

1 Input

2 Outputs